How to Convert PDF to JSON: A Complete Guide

Introduction to PDF to JSON Conversion

Converting PDF files to JSON format has become increasingly important in today's data-driven world. JSON (JavaScript Object Notation) offers a structured, machine-readable format that's perfect for data interchange, API responses, and database storage. This guide will walk you through everything you need to know about how to convert pdf to json efficiently.

Why Convert PDF to JSON?

There are several compelling reasons to convert PDF to JSON:

Methods for PDF to JSON Conversion

1. Online PDF to JSON Converters

Online converters offer a quick and easy way to convert pdf to json without installing any software. These tools typically provide a user-friendly interface where you can upload your PDF file and download the converted JSON. However, be cautious with sensitive documents when using online services.

2. Programming Libraries

For developers, programming libraries offer more flexibility and control over the conversion process. Popular options include:

3. Desktop Software

Desktop applications provide a balance between ease of use and advanced features. These tools often offer batch processing capabilities and more customization options compared to online converters.

Best Practices for PDF to JSON Conversion

1. Understand Your PDF Structure

Before converting, analyze the PDF structure to determine how the data is organized. This will help you create a more meaningful JSON structure that preserves the original data relationships.

2. Choose the Right Conversion Method

Select a conversion method based on your specific needs, considering factors like document complexity, volume, security requirements, and technical expertise.

3. Validate the Output

Always validate the JSON output to ensure it's well-formed and contains all the expected data. Use tools like JSON Validation to check your converted files.

4. Handle Special Characters

Pay attention to special characters, encoding issues, and formatting that might not translate perfectly from PDF to JSON. Implement proper handling for these edge cases.

Common Challenges and Solutions

Challenge 1: Complex Layouts

PDFs with complex layouts, tables, and formatting can be challenging to convert accurately. Solution: Use specialized libraries that can handle complex layouts or preprocess the PDF to simplify its structure.

Challenge 2: Large Files

Large PDF files can cause memory issues during conversion. Solution: Implement streaming or chunked processing to handle large files without overwhelming system resources.

Challenge 3: Scanned Documents

Scanned PDFs contain images rather than text, making direct conversion impossible. Solution: Use OCR (Optical Character Recognition) tools before attempting PDF to JSON conversion.

Advanced Techniques for PDF to JSON Conversion

Using OCR for Scanned PDFs

For scanned documents, OCR technology is essential. OCR converts images of text into machine-readable text that can then be processed for JSON conversion. Modern OCR tools offer high accuracy even with low-quality scans.

Custom Data Extraction

For specific use cases, you might need custom extraction rules. This involves identifying patterns in your PDFs and creating extraction logic tailored to your specific document types.

Batch Processing

When dealing with multiple PDFs, batch processing can save significant time. Many tools offer batch conversion features that can process multiple files simultaneously or in sequence.

Tools for PDF to JSON Conversion

While there are many tools available, some stand out for their reliability and features. For example, if your conversion process involves extracting tabular data that needs to be converted to JSON, you might first convert CSV to JSON using specialized tools. Our CSV to JSON Converter is perfect for this intermediate step.

FAQ Section

Q: What is the best way to convert PDF to JSON?

A: The best method depends on your specific needs. For occasional conversions, online tools might suffice. For regular conversions, programming libraries offer more flexibility. For batch processing, desktop software might be ideal.

Q: Can I convert password-protected PDFs to JSON?

A: Yes, but you'll need to provide the password during the conversion process. Most tools and libraries support password-protected PDFs.

Q: Will the conversion preserve the original formatting?

A: PDF to JSON conversion focuses on data extraction rather than visual formatting. The JSON will contain the structured data but won't preserve the exact visual layout of the PDF.

Q: Is it possible to convert PDF to JSON programmatically?

A: Yes, most programming languages offer libraries for PDF to JSON conversion. This allows for automation and integration into larger workflows.

Q: How accurate is PDF to JSON conversion?

A: Accuracy depends on the quality of the PDF and the conversion method used. Clean, text-based PDFs typically convert with high accuracy, while scanned or complex layouts may require additional processing.

Conclusion

Converting PDF to JSON is a valuable skill in the modern data landscape. Whether you're integrating with APIs, storing data in databases, or automating workflows, understanding how to convert pdf to json opens up numerous possibilities for data utilization.

Remember to choose the right method for your needs, validate your outputs, and consider the specific characteristics of your PDF documents. With the right tools and techniques, PDF to JSON conversion can be a seamless part of your data processing toolkit.

Start Converting Today

Ready to convert your PDFs to JSON? Whether you need a quick conversion or a sophisticated batch processing solution, there's a tool or method that fits your needs. For intermediate conversions involving CSV data, check out our CSV to JSON Converter to handle that part of your workflow efficiently.

Don't let valuable data remain locked in PDF format. Start exploring PDF to JSON conversion options today and unlock the potential of your document data!